How many HK MTR stations are there?


How many HK MTR stations are there? In addition to the 98 metro stations listed on this page, the MTR system also consists of 68 light rail stops and one high-speed rail terminus in the city.

What is the closest MTR station to Sai Kung?

Unfortunately, there are no MTR stations that will get you directly to Sai Kung. Well, not yet anyway. The closest station is Hang Hau Station. Alternatively, you can get off at Mong Kok Station or Choi Hung Station to take a minibus to Sai Kung.

What is the deepest MTR station?

St Petersburg's metro is the world's deepest line, based on an average depth of 60 metres (HKU is the deepest station on the Hong Kong MTR, at 70 metres, by comparison). Burrowed even further underground is Arsenalna station, Kiev, which lies 105.5 metres beneath the Ukrainian capital and is the deepest on the planet.

Does Hong Kong MTR run 24 hours?

HK MTR hours start from around 06:00 in the early morning to the last train at about 01:00 at midnight. Most metro trains will run about 19 hours per day. In some holidays like Christmas Eve and New Year's Eve, Hong Kong MTR stations will provide overnight service.

What is the main train station in Hong Kong?

There are two main train stations in Hong Kong - Hong Kong West Kowloon Station and Hung Hom Railway Station. Currently, there are only high-speed trains depart from West Kowloon Station for the major cities in Guangdong province, including Guangzhou, Shenzhen, Donguan, Humen, Foshan, Sanshui, and Zhaoqing.

What is the oldest MTR station in Hong Kong?

Originally opening in late 1979, Tsim Sha Tsui Station was among the first MTR stations to begin operations. It came after the extension of the very first MTR line a few months earlier connecting Kwun Tong and Shek Kip Mei stations (now on the Kwun Tong Line).
